网络安全流量如何识别与拦截恶意代码?
在当今数字化时代,网络安全问题日益凸显,恶意代码的威胁更是无处不在。如何有效识别与拦截恶意代码,成为网络安全领域的一大挑战。本文将深入探讨网络安全流量如何识别与拦截恶意代码,为企业和个人提供有效的防护策略。
一、恶意代码的类型及特点
恶意代码是指那些具有恶意目的的计算机程序,主要包括病毒、木马、蠕虫、后门等。以下列举几种常见的恶意代码类型及其特点:
病毒:通过自我复制,感染其他程序或文件,破坏计算机系统。
木马:隐藏在正常程序中,窃取用户信息,控制计算机。
蠕虫:通过网络传播,感染其他计算机,占用系统资源。
后门:在系统中植入,为攻击者提供远程控制。
二、网络安全流量识别恶意代码的方法
- 特征码识别
特征码识别是网络安全流量识别恶意代码的基本方法。通过分析恶意代码的特征,如文件名、文件大小、文件类型、代码结构等,建立特征码数据库。当网络流量中的数据与特征码数据库中的恶意代码特征相匹配时,即可识别出恶意代码。
- 行为分析
行为分析是通过分析程序运行过程中的异常行为来识别恶意代码。例如,恶意代码可能会尝试访问系统关键文件、修改注册表、发送大量数据等。通过监测这些异常行为,可以识别出恶意代码。
- 机器学习
机器学习技术在网络安全流量识别恶意代码方面具有显著优势。通过训练大量样本数据,机器学习模型可以自动识别恶意代码。随着技术的不断发展,基于机器学习的恶意代码识别方法将更加精准。
- 沙箱技术
沙箱技术是一种隔离环境,用于检测和阻止恶意代码。将可疑文件放入沙箱中运行,观察其行为,如果发现异常,则将其视为恶意代码。沙箱技术可以有效识别和拦截恶意代码。
三、网络安全流量拦截恶意代码的策略
- 防火墙
防火墙是网络安全的第一道防线,可以拦截来自外部的恶意代码。通过设置防火墙规则,限制对特定端口和IP地址的访问,可以有效防止恶意代码入侵。
- 入侵检测系统(IDS)
入侵检测系统可以实时监测网络流量,识别和拦截恶意代码。当检测到可疑行为时,IDS会发出警报,提醒管理员采取措施。
- 终端安全软件
终端安全软件可以安装在计算机上,实时监测和拦截恶意代码。当发现恶意代码时,终端安全软件会将其隔离或删除。
- 安全培训
提高员工的安全意识,让他们了解恶意代码的危害和防范措施,是拦截恶意代码的重要手段。通过安全培训,员工可以自觉遵守网络安全规定,降低恶意代码入侵的风险。
案例分析:
某企业网络遭受恶意代码攻击,导致大量数据泄露。通过分析网络安全流量,发现攻击者利用漏洞植入木马,窃取企业机密。企业立即采取措施,关闭受感染终端,隔离网络,并更新安全软件。同时,加强员工安全培训,提高网络安全意识。经过一系列措施,企业成功拦截恶意代码,避免了更大的损失。
总结:
网络安全流量识别与拦截恶意代码是网络安全领域的重要任务。通过特征码识别、行为分析、机器学习、沙箱技术等方法,可以有效识别恶意代码。同时,防火墙、入侵检测系统、终端安全软件、安全培训等策略,可以帮助企业和个人拦截恶意代码,保障网络安全。在数字化时代,加强网络安全防护,刻不容缓。
猜你喜欢:云原生APM